Duzdag is an impressive mountain located in the Eastern Anatolia Region of Turkey, specifically in Erzurum province. Its height and natural beauty attract both local and international tourists. While Duzdag is a popular destination for winter sports enthusiasts, it also offers excellent opportunities for trekking and nature walks during the summer months.
Standing at approximately 3,000 meters, Duzdag is truly remarkable. Its snow-covered surface in winter creates a perfect playground for skiers. Additionally, the natural lakes at the foot of the mountain and the rich vegetation provide a fantastic atmosphere for those looking to explore the area. The view from the summit of Duzdag is breathtaking, with the surrounding mountains and valleys showcasing stunning beauty.
The best time to visit Duzdag is during the winter months. The ski season is active from December to March, with various ski resorts in the area open for business. In the summer, visitors can enjoy hiking and camping activities. Thanks to its proximity to Erzurum city center, getting there is quite easy. Duzdag is an ideal spot for those looking to enjoy nature and engage in adrenaline-pumping activities.
